1. Take care of your scalp: Your scalp is like the foundation for healthy hair growth. To promote hair growth, it’s essential to maintain a clean and healthy scalp. Start by using a gentle shampoo and conditioner that is free of harsh chemicals. Massage your scalp regularly to stimulate blood flow and encourage hair growth. You can also try using essential oils, like rosemary or peppermint, to nourish and invigorate your scalp.
2. Eat a balanced diet: Your hair needs proper nutrition to grow strong and healthy. Make sure to include foods that are rich in vitamins, minerals, and protein in your daily diet. Foods like eggs, nuts, fruits, and vegetables provide essential nutrients that promote hair growth. Additionally, drink plenty of water to keep your hair hydrated and prevent breakage.
3. Avoid heat and styling damage: Excessive heat styling and harsh hair treatments can cause damage and lead to hair loss. Limit your use of hot styling tools, such as straighteners and curling irons, and always use a heat protectant spray. Avoid tight hairstyles that pull on your hair, as this can also cause breakage. Opt for gentle, low-heat styling options and embrace your natural hair texture as much as possible.
4. Try natural remedies: There are several natural remedies that can help stimulate hair growth. For example, applying aloe vera gel or onion juice to your scalp can promote hair growth and nourish your follicles. You can also try rinsing your hair with green tea or apple cider vinegar to remove buildup and promote a healthy scalp. Experiment with different natural remedies to find what works best for your hair.
5. Take supplements: Sometimes, our bodies need a little extra help to promote hair growth. Consider taking hair growth supplements, like biotin or collagen, to provide your hair with the nutrients it needs to grow. Consult with your doctor or a nutritionist before starting any new supplements to ensure they are safe and suitable for you.
6. Manage stress levels: Stress can have a negative impact on your overall health, including your hair. High-stress levels can lead to hair loss and hinder hair growth. Find healthy ways to manage stress, such as practicing meditation, exercising, or engaging in hobbies that bring you joy. Taking care of your mental well-being is just as important as taking care of your physical health.

The Role of Nutrition in Hair Growth
When it comes to hair growth, nutrition plays a crucial role. Your hair needs a variety of vitamins, minerals, and proteins to grow strong and healthy. Incorporating foods that are rich in these nutrients into your daily diet can help boost hair growth and improve the overall health of your hair.
Here are some hair-friendly foods to include in your meals:
– Eggs: They are packed with protein, biotin, and B vitamins, all of which promote hair growth.
– Spinach: Rich in iron, vitamin A, and vitamin C, spinach helps in the production of sebum, which keeps the scalp moisturized and promotes hair growth.
– Sweet potatoes: These are a great source of beta-carotene, which is converted to vitamin A in the body. Vitamin A is essential for healthy hair growth.
– Salmon: High in omega-3 fatty acids, protein, and vitamin D, salmon nourishes the hair follicles and supports hair growth.
– Greek yogurt: Packed with protein, vitamin B5, and vitamin D, Greek yogurt strengthens the hair and reduces hair breakage.
Incorporating these foods into your diet can make a noticeable difference in the health and growth of your hair. Remember, a well-nourished body leads to well-nourished hair!
The Importance of Protecting Your Hair from Heat Damage
We all love rocking stylish hairstyles, but excessive heat styling can cause significant damage to your hair. Heat from styling tools can strip your hair of its natural moisture, making it dry, brittle, and prone to breakage.
So, how can you protect your hair from heat damage without sacrificing your style? Here are a few tips:
– Use a heat protectant spray: Before using any hot styling tools, apply a heat protectant spray to your hair. This helps create a barrier between your hair and the heat, reducing the damage.
– Lower the heat setting: Whenever possible, use the lowest heat setting on your styling tools. High heat isn’t always necessary and can cause more damage than good.
– Limit heat styling: Try to give your hair a break from heat styling every now and then. Embrace your natural hair texture or experiment with heat-free hairstyles, like braids or updos.
– Opt for heatless styling methods: There are plenty of heatless styling options available, such as flexi rods, foam rollers, or overnight braiding. These methods create beautiful curls and waves without the use of heat.
By taking these precautions, you can protect your hair from heat damage and promote healthier hair growth. Your hair will thank you!
